Re: Celts Raise Their Arms and Bang On a Pan, Scare The Bears! Victory Cigar vs MEM 3/31
RB34 wrote:Anyone worried about JTs efficiency?
he's taking a lot of junk iso 3s, which I hope are just regular season 'filler'. Last May and June he cranked up his # of drives to the basket, and as long as we see that again when it matters I'm good.
But: if posting JT up from 20 feet is a new focal point of our offense, I don't love it. Saw that quite a bit last night and it led to a lot of predictable fadeaway long 2s. Can imagine that's just late-season 'filler' too -- or trying to develop it as a backup option if needed in the playoffs for a limited # of possessions -- getting him doing it poorly and well on film now could be of some benefit.

Re: Celts Raise Their Arms and Bang On a Pan, Scare The Bears! Victory Cigar vs MEM 3/31
cl2117 wrote:Horford playing 37 minutes kind of scares me. Don't want to wear the tread off those tires too early, make sure he gets plenty of rest. 26/8 with good defense and basically 50% from three, if he can give us the occassional performance like that in the playoffs we're going to be pretty damned hard to beat. I get keeping him warm but I'd like to see him closer to 20 mins max.
I think the same initially. But, I think Joe's theory on this is that you can't go from playing 20 mpg to all of a sudden doing 30+ in the playoffs, so he likes to extend guys a little. Then give them days off instead. Al didn't play against SAS, so Joe felt fine to extend him a little.
I'm not 100% positive I'm on board (extend him to 32 min instead of 37, lol), but I can see the logic.
